Free fans and cooling assistance from Horry County Salvation Army.

Most years the Salvation Army of Horry County tries to help low income, seniors, and needy families beat the heat. The charity organization is involved in collecting fans and possibly air conditioning units and then providing these items to the needy. The non-profit is also involved distributing cash to needy families in Horry County. All of the programs are focused on helping people make it through the hot South Carolina summer.

Recent statements from the Salvation Army indicate that they have more people than ever coming to them seeking help. Energy, utility and cooling bill assistance is one of the services that are in highest demand.

One of the greatest needs they see is during the summer, and it is from low income and seniors who need to stay cool. The requests also include financial assistance with paying utility bills. During the hot and humid summer people are just trying to stay cool. So free fans and other aid may be able to help meet that need.

In past years a program known as the FANtastic fan drive was initiated by the Salvation Army. The organization is here to help Myrtle Beach, Conway, and Horry County families pay a portion of their utility bill. Or if that can’t be done, they will try to provide a free fan to help keep people cool during the summer according to the Director of Social Services for the Salvation Army in Horry County. The non-profit will distribute to the elderly and the needy whatever dollars or fans are received and are on hand.  The need for help during the summer is that great.

Most of the assistance programs work off of donations from the community, including individuals and local businesses. All donations are tax deductible. Fans can be dropped off at The Salvation Army’s Family Store, which is located in Myrtle Beach, 212 N. Kings Hwy, Myrtle Beach, South Carolina.

 

 

 

 

The main office of the Salvation Army Social Service Office is located at 1400 Church Street, Conway, SC. Individuals can stop by there for information and access to all of their resources, including emergency rent assistance, case management, food, and more. Phone (843) 488-2769.

To make monetary donations to the summer cooling programs, money can be sent to The Salvation Army, P.O. Box 500, Conway, South Carolina 29528. Funds will go towards buying fans and/or direct assistance for paying cooling and utility bills.
